A boat capsized on the Shagari River, drowning 28 people

On Tuesday evening, a boat capsized in northwestern Nigeria as it attempted to cross a river to get firewood, killing at least 28 people. After rescue personnel and volunteers retrieved their bodies from the River Shagari in Sokoto state, regional government official Aliyu Dantani stated that most of the victims were teenage girls. Nigerian gang raids kill and kidnap dozens in the northern Plateau

A series of raids in Plateau State, central Nigeria, resulted in the deaths of dozens of people and the abduction of many more. People on motorcycles with guns attacked at least four small communities near Kanam on Sunday. They also stole livestock and set fire to a number of houses. It’s the latest in a […]

Gambians vote in legislative elections to strengthen democracy

Gambian citizens are voting for legislators in parliamentary elections that are expected to enhance President Adama Barrow’s grip on power following his re-election last year. On Saturday, voters in the West African state will renew the 58 seats in the unicameral National Assembly for a five-year term. The single-round vote will help elect 53 parliamentarians, […]

Kenya’s Cost Of Living Surges Amid Rising Food And Fuel Prices

Kenya’s cost of living is increasing rapidly amid rising food and fuel prices. The inflation rate rose to 5.56 per cent in March from 5.08 per cent in February because of the surge in the prices of key household items like cooking gas, food, and petrol.
